What should I do if my equipment isn’t working?

A.

  1. Check your thermostat to make sure it is turned on.
  2. If the thermostat has batteries, check to see if the batteries need replaced.
  3. Check the fuses to make sure they aren’t burnt out.
  4. Check that the breakers are turned on.
  5. Make sure the service switch on the furnace is turned on.
  6. Check your filter. If it’s dirty, replace the filter and leave the equipment off with the fan in the ‘on’position for 30 minutes. Do this before turning the heat or cooling back on.

How often should I change my filter?

A. How often to change your furnace filter really depends on a number of factors: Some of the main considerations include:

  • Number of people living in your home- the more people in the home, the more dust and debris that will be floating in the air
  • Recent construction in the home- Dust and debris from drywall and other construction materials will require the filter to be changed more frequently
  • Smokers- The chemicals in smoke can clog up filters.
  • Allergies, Asthma, or other Respiratory or Immune Deficiency- People with these problems need the air to be as clean as possible, and one way to achieve that is through frequent filter changes
  • Quality of filter
  • Pets- Pets have a tendency to shed, which can clog your air filter

Every home is different and how often you are running your equipment, where your house is located and even the style of filter can affect how often you should change your filter. For your standard 1”-3” air filters, the manufacturers basically tell you to change them every 30-60 days, which is actually a great rule of thumb. If you fall into any of the categories above, you should regularly check your filter to see if it requires changing.

How often should I have my system maintenanced?

A. In order for your equipment to function properly, it’s best to have it serviced twice annually, in the spring and the fall. This not only ensures maximum efficiency, it enables us to foresee any possible problems that may occur in the near future.
